What is a PPT file?
A PPT file, or PowerPoint presentation, is a file format used by Microsoft PowerPoint to create slideshows. These files often consist of text, images, videos, and other multimedia elements that provide a visual representation of information.

What should you consider when choosing a tool to shorten PPT file size?
-
Compatibility: Ensure the tool works with your preferred file formats.
-
Ease of use: Look for an intuitive interface.
-
Speed: Check reviews for performance related to compression time.
-
Quality: Determine the impact on the presentation quality.
